Medical professionals stress that parents need to chat to the kid's doctor if they think a vision problem. "If captured early enough, at 3 or 4 years of ages, children's eye problems are very treatable," says Beebe, who has actually practiced optometry for 27 years. Right here are some means to tackle finding an optometrist that meets your requirements, according to the National Eye Institute of the National Institutes of Wellness (NIH): Discover if your insurance provider or health insurance plan has a list of ophthalmologist who are covered under your strategy.
Ask various other wellness professionals, such as a family members doctor or main care medical professional, nurses, pharmacologists or dentists, if they can refer you to eye medical professionals they such as. Call the optometry or ophthalmology division at a local medical facility or college medical center. Get in touch with a state or area association of optometrists or eye doctors to see if they have checklists of optometrist with specific details on specialized and experience.

Eye care can be costly. The bright side is that there are programs that use complimentary or low-cost eye tests and glasses. Some medical insurance plans additionally supply cost-free vision screenings and aid to cover the cost of other eye treatment services, also.
